Wpis z mikrobloga

via Wykop Mobilny (Android)
  • 0
Jak chce sobie zapisać w spring data w relacji many to many ale bez duplikatów to jak to najlepiej zrobić? Bo mam sobie Book i Category, category ma unique name. No i przy dodawaniu ksiazki chce sobie dodać kategorie które nie istnieją a te co istnieją to tylko przypisac do tej książki, i już probowałem z 1000 rzeczy i jestem debilem help xD

Na zasadzie:

Book {
title:"blabla",
categories:[{name:"horror"},{name:"drama"}]
}
No i np horror już istnieje to jakbym dał cascaseType persist to wywala exception że duplikat chce być zapisany. Chciałbym go tylko przypisać do ksiazki a drame jak nie istnieje jeszcze w bazie to stworzyć i też przypisać.

#spring #springdata #java #jpa #hibernate
  • 1
  • Odpowiedz